Main Services
When you see a note about all main services, it implies that the property has
electricity, gas, water and main drainage connected, unless stated otherwise.
That said, if gas is particularly critical to you, please check specifically,
since some villages have no gas supply and hence nobody thinks to mention it.
Private
drainage will mean either a septic tank, which will need emptying infrequently,
or a cesspit which may require more regular attention. Don’t dismiss either
out of hand as both systems can work well – and the water rates will be
less than would otherwise be the case. This saving can often exceed the maintenance
costs.
A telephone service is normally available nation-wide, and increasingly cable
in urban locations, but again please check what is connected to any property you
are looking to buy as these connections are not necessarily included in the expression
‘all main services’.
